Mint specimen of Merchant Navy Medal (2005-), in presentation box. Obverse: Profile portrait of Vice-Admiral Horatio Nelson (1758-1805) facing left. Legend: 'THE MERCHANT NAVY MEDAL 1805 . TRAFALGAR . 2005'. Reverse: The Merchant Navy badge. Legend: 'FOR MERITORIOUS SERVICE'. The Merchant Navy Medal recognises and rewards meritorious service and acts of courage performed by British registered seafarers and members of the UK fishing fleets of all ranks. It was founded as a charitable initiative in 2005.
